Analyst Troels "syndereN" Nielsen commented on the regional qualifiers for The International 2026. He shared his thoughts in the We Say Things podcast.
According to the Dane, direct invitations to the tournament were apparently confirmed even before the end of DreamLeague Season 29.

If the tournament results were taken into account, the eighth invite would surely have gone to PARIVISION – after all, they won the S-tier competition. But the invitations were announced almost immediately after the finals, so PV's victory was not considered. They just got unlucky.
The analyst also spoke about what he considers a weak lineup of participants in the North American qualifiers.

But here we have one team, and everything else is stacks put together specifically for the qualifiers, not even permanent rosters. It would be a huge disappointment for the region if GamerLegion does not make it.
The North American qualifiers for The International 2026 will take place from June 24 to June 26 and will compete for one slot.
